  From our perspective here, we would love to see:

- stronger animation support (maybe including xform, skeletal, tweening, 
texture)
- strong art path (Collada would handle this)
- 3D GUI toolkit
- Native Physics. 

We've had some great success with Ageia's PhysX in OpenSG. Performance was 
great and there's even the option for fluids, cloth, softbodies, etc. If we had 
to pick one of the above features, animation support would be it...without 
question.
